A new series of fast motor load
controls designed specifically to monitor and protect valuable industrial
machinery and equipment has been released by sensing specialist Vydas
International Marketing.
The New Fast Response Digital Motor
Load Control manufactured by Load Controls Inc (USA) monitors true motor power
and detects common machinery problems such overloads, jams, obstructions, loss
of load, sudden load changes, missing tools or misplaced parts.
The PFR-1550 single set point
control, with high or low trip, detects overload or loss of load while PFR-1750
two set point control can trip an alarm and stop the machine with independent
relay outputs. The ROC-50 rate of change control is ideal for use with conveyers
and material handling equipment and detects sudden changes in load. This sensor
has a rate of change set point plus gross overload. The model CR-150 single
point current sensor is also available for special circumstances where it is
required to measure current gross overload only. All models have a 4-20mA output
to send load information to instrumentation, computers, chart recorders or data
logger’s etc. In order to avoid the possibility of nuisance trips during use
or at motor start up, all models also have adjustable digital start up and trip
timers.
These sensors are housed in a
compact rugged polycarbonate waterproof enclosure, with large digital display
(HP or KW) plus keypad and can be mounted on a door, inside a control cabinet or
surface panel mounted with included bezel kit. Settings can easily be seen on
the digital display at the touch of a button. Electrical connections are made
via convenient plug and socket terminal strips on the rear of the unit.
A unique range finder toroid is
included to allowing fast easy set up of motors up to 50HP connected directly.
Larger motors require optional current transformers to be used in conjunction
with the range finder toroid.
This product range is designed to
cope with the most difficult of motor load sensing tasks when other power
sensors and motor load controls are unable to function reliably. The control and
reliability of many process machines such as grinders, mills, mixers, rollers,
pumps, compressors, conveyers etc may be improved dramatically by sensing true
power instead of only current thus saving down time and loss of production. In
practice, it doesn’t matter however sophisticated the control computer system,
its overall system performance is very much dependant on the sensors at the
front end!!
Measuring power on the output of
variable frequency drives is a special case, as voltage and current transformers
do not work at low or high frequencies. In this case, waveforms on both the
input and output of a drive, are distorted and will cause gross errors in the
measurement of power. Where variable frequency or inverter drives are fitted the
"V" Series Fast Response Motor Load Controls should be used in
conjunction with the unique Universal Power Cell designed for this purpose. The
UPC is fitted with "Hall Effect" sensors that are not affected by odd
wave shapes or frequencies.
